Assuming rocket is getting punched by a melee hero, if both heroes start moving in the same direction, they could probably punch rocket to death by the time there was enough distance between them.

Now vertically, hulk could get a good 4 punches in before you're high enough not to get hit, and then he can jump and keep wailing. The difference between 6 and 8 is not that big in actuality.

Panther moves at 7 and climbs at 10, dd is 6 and 10, thor is 6.5 and can shoot, venom and spidy run on walls at 9 (not that spidy would need to do that to catch up to you anyway), and the list go on. Those who can shoot, you're never leaving their effective range anymore if they managed to get semi-close no matter the direction you crawl.

(Even factoring dashes and pre-nerf, hyper mobile heroes like Spidy, Angela, Starlord, Psy, DD, Iron Fist, even Thor, etc. could catch up pretty reliably, and now it is even easier for them to beam you down whenever.)

20% nerf in speed, going from 10 to 8 doesn't sound that big, but remember when Loki's clones got nerfed to be 20% less effective? That literally killed Loki for a while.

This nerf in movement for Rocket crossed the threshold where it makes it not viable as an active evasion tool to dodge and juke enemies who are close and chasing you. You can still use it to reposition and crawl to safety if you have lots of distance already to reach high ground and escape low mobility heroes, but those who can move, they just don't struggle to catch up anymore.

Moreover, it nerfed many other aspects of Rocket's gameplay.

Bunny hopping is dead.
Map traversal is cut in effectiveness (reaching the fight after respawning for example)
Much harder to move around in order to gank a flier or the enemy backline.
Much lower chances to survive if getting shot at or chased and you wanna get out of the way.
Much lower healing output when doing the aerial Rocket style, since now you have to crawl for longer in order to maintain the same altitude between healing volleys.
Lower healing output and slower beacon placement on some maps since you have to spend more time on the walls to reach whatever location you're aiming for.

In short, no it is not fully useless, but it did become useless in many, many scenarios where it used to be good, and became less effective in every single other one.

His weakness is that he has no agency over anyone else. His only way to interact with his foes is his primary, so no stuns, blocks, pulls, knock backs, or anything to influence other players, and even though his gun can do lots of dmg, it is very honest damage, not bursty in any way and still higher ttk than everyone in the roster except tanks and maybe Jeff.

If they land their shots, rocket will lose any engagement before he can kill them.

And so, the strength that his crawl passive gave him along with the dashes was agency over himself instead.

He felt like he always had options to live, and if he didn't, it didn't feel unfair. It was what marked good vs bad rockets: how well they could move around.

Plus, crawling meant he was effectively out of the fight for that period of time anyway, since he's healing neither himself nor his teammates.

All the crawl nerf does is reduce his self agency and lower his skill ceiling, as well as make him much, much more killable.

The problem is that 2 m/s is not enough to actually disengage.

Rocket can crawl 60m in about 7.7 seconds now, someone like DD can do it in 9.8, and Thor can do it in 9 seconds. A difference of 1 or 2 seconds over such a distance is still within melee range for Thor, and this is just walking, with no gap closers, which most other heroes have too in some form, not to mention that also plenty of them can shoot.

Horizontal evasion is not really viable anymore, only vertical if they're melee and have no way to get up there, and the rest can still shoot over long distances.

So before, the speed was enough to disengage except only against hyper mobiles like spider, Angela or cheaper hall. Now everyone just kinda keeps up, shooting all the while.

It is nonsense to express it on a base of reducing it only from 10 to 8

Why? Because 6 is the default. We move by 6 all the time, and so it is the baseline upon which the passive is added on, meaning that the passive effectively was "Move 4m/s faster while crawling"

It was +4 m, now it is +2 m. So they did nerf the passive by 50 percent.
